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Start Real Conversations
Feeling unsure what to say is normal. Turn that worry into a few reliable patterns you can adapt so your first message feels natural, not rehearsed.
Easy opener patterns
- Profile hook + quick question: Spot something specific in their photos or bio and ask a one-line question. Example: "I see you hiked Table Rock — what trail would you recommend for someone who gets distracted by views?"
- Two-option prompt: Offer a light choice to make answering easy. Example: "Coffee or tea for Sunday morning recovery?"
- Curiosity with a small reveal: Share something small about you then invite a reply. Example: "I collect odd postcards. What’s the strangest souvenir you’ve brought home?"
- Light callback to a shared interest: If you both like a band/show/hobby, reference it briefly. Example: "You mentioned loving vinyl — what record do you play when you need a pick-me-up?"
How to keep it low-pressure
- Ask open-ended but easy-to-answer questions (avoid anything that feels like an interview).
- Use simple punctuation and one or two sentences—brevity invites replies.
- Keep tone friendly and curious, not intense or overly flattering.
Avoid these common traps
- Generic greetings like "hey" or "hi" alone. Add one detail so it’s not a dead end.
- Forced compliments that sound scripted. Mention specifics instead: a photo, hobby, or line from their bio.
- Overly personal or heavy questions on the first message. Save deep topics for later.
- Copy-paste openers that don’t match the profile. Small customization goes a long way.
Quick templates to customize
- "Love your [photo/bio detail]. What’s the story behind it?"
- "Complete this sentence: [fun prompt]. I’ll go first: [short answer]."
- "I’m torn between [A] and [B] — which would you pick?"
- "You seem to enjoy [activity]. Any beginner tips for someone interested?"
Pick one pattern, tweak it to match the profile, and send it without overthinking. Small, specific touches make your message feel real—and make it easy for the other person to reply.
